Considerations To Know About pet hotels dubai
By meticulously assessing Just about every pet shop based on these conditions, we were capable of detect the five best pet shops in Dubai that excel in all elements of pet care and customer service.The Petshop stands out as a preferred pet megastore in Dubai, with its flagship location in Dubai Financial investment Park. This expansive pet shop pro